Louis Jean Desprez, La Victoire d'Hogland Swedish, Swedish chief ship Gustaf III after the battle of Hogland 1788, painting, 1794, Oil on canvas, Height, 359 cm (11.7 ft), Width, 422 cm (13.8 ft), Inscriptions, Signering, Desprez b. 1794

This print showcases Louis Jean Desprez's masterpiece, "La Victoire d'Hogland Swedish" depicting the Swedish chief ship Gustaf III after the battle of Hogland in 1788. Painted in 1794 with oil on canvas, this monumental artwork measures an impressive height of 359 cm (11.7 ft) and a width of 422 cm (13.8 ft).
